 HFTP Establishes Student Chapter at Hong Kong Polytechnic University; 
HFTP Also Bringing GUESTROOM 2010 Presentation to HOFEX
.
AUSTIN, TEXAS (May 10, 2007) � Hospitality Financial and Technology Professionals� (HFTP®) CEO and executive vice president, Frank Wolfe, CAE, and HFTP�s international president, Agnes DeFranco, Ed.D., CHAE, will travel to Hong Kong to represent HFTP at one of the largest hospitality service industry shows in the world. While in Hong Kong they will participate in the education program of HOFEX 2007 (Asian International Exhibition of Food & Drink, Hotel, Restaurant & Foodservice Equipment, Supplies & Services) and represent HFTP as the HOFEX Welcome Reception sponsor. In addition they will celebrate the newly-formed HFTP Hong Kong Polytechnic University Student Chapter.

HFTP is scheduled to present three educational sessions based on the technology featured in its GUESTROOM 2010 at the upcoming HOFEX. The presentations, given by Wolfe, will provide an in-depth look at the latest and near-future guestroom technology featured in the popular HFTP exhibit, GUESTROOM 2010.

HOFEX will be held May 13�16 at the Hong Kong Convention & Exhibition Centre. Wolfe will speak with 200+ hotel general managers from the Asia Pacific region on May 13 at 3 p.m. about future technology for hotels, including biometrics and robotics. He will also present two other GUESTROOM 2010 sessions on May 14 at 5 p.m. and May 15 at 2:15 p.m.

"The GUESTROOM 2010 Technology Advisory Council conducted extensive research on technology, searching for guestroom technology that would be realistic, as well as provide �wows� to stimulate conversation," said Wolfe. "We have had a very enthusiastic response to the exhibit, with many shows inviting us to put it on display. While it wouldn't be feasible to take the full exhibit on the road, we have instead devised a comprehensive GUESTROOM 2010 presentation, giving us a more manageable format to travel with."

DeFranco will speak to the Hong Kong Controllers Association at the Marco Polo Hotel, May 15 at 2:30 p.m. She will also give a presentation on teaching and learning to the faculty of Hong Kong Polytechnic University on May 16 at 2:30 p.m.

HFTP will participate in a reception at HOFEX by co-sponsoring the event with Who Is Who In Hospitality (WIWIH), which will be held on May 15 at the Grand Hyatt Hong Kong.

While in Hong Kong, Wolfe and DeFranco will visit the newly formed HFTP Hong Kong Polytechnic University Student Chapter on Friday, May 11 at the Millennium Restaurant to celebrate its charter, with both DeFranco and Wolfe addressing the newly formed chapter. It is the second student chapter outside of North America, with the first at the Ecole Hoteliere Lausanne in Switzerland.

�The establishment of the HFTP student chapter at Hong Kong Polytechnic University is the first of its kind in Asia,� said Henry Tsai, Ph.D., CHE, HFTP student chapter advisor. �It will provide a forum for those students who are keen on making a difference in the profession of finance and technology in the hospitality industry.�

HFTP student chapters offer student members the ability to communicate with their peers regarding today�s challenges in the job market. Student chapters also provide great resources and educational programs to keep students on the leading edge of finance and technology in the hospitality industry.

About GUESTROOM 2010

GUESTROOM 2010 is a model guestroom featuring some of the latest and near-future technologies for the modern hotel room, including extreme innovations like a bed without a mattress, and the more practical self-cleaning shower. The model guestroom, which debuted to maximum capacity crowds at the 2006 Hospitality Industry Technology Exposition and Conference (HITEC®) in Minneapolis, Minn., will unveil a new version at HITEC 2007 in Orlando, Fla. About HFTP

HFTP, Austin, Texas, USA and Maastricht, The Netherlands, founded in 1952, is the global professional association for financial and technology personnel working in hotels, clubs and other hospitality-related businesses. HFTP provides first class educational opportunities, research, and publications to more than 4,600 members globally including, the premiere hospitality technology conference HITEC--founded in 1972. HFTP also awards the only hospitality specific certifications for accounting and technology ---the Certified Hospitality Accountant Executive (CHAE) and the Certified Hospitality Technology Professional (CHTP) designations. HFTP was founded in the USA as the National Association of Hotel Accountants. For more information, visit www.hftp.org
